Conditions / Refusal Reasons
That the development be carried out strictly in accordance with the particulars of the development contained in application S.29/03 as shown on plan numbers 4060789/OXF/A4001, A4004, A4006, A4010, A4011 and A4053 accompanying the application except as controlled or modified by conditions of this permission, unless otherwise agreed in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development.
Reason: To ensure the details of the development are carried out in accordance with the application as approved.
That development must be begun not later than the expiration of five years beginning with the date hereof.
Reason: By virtue of the provisions of Section 91 (1) (a) of the Town and Country Planning Act, 1990.
That the external walls and roofs of the buildings be constructed and finished in accordance with a Schedule of Materials and Finishes which shall first have been submitted to and appro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development.
Reason: To ensure the Materials and Finishes are compatible with the surrounding development. (Policy: G2 (OSP2011); G2 (OSP2016); G8 (SOLP); C2 (SOLP2011)).
That the land be landscaped and planted with trees and shrubs in accordance with a comprehensive planting and landscaping scheme first approved by the Head of Sustainable Development and that trees and shrubs so planted be properly maintained and that in the event of any of the trees or shrubs dying or being seriously damaged or destroyed within a period of five years from the completion of the development a new tree or shrub or equivalent number of trees or shrubs as the case may be, be planted and properly maintained in a position or positions as first approved by the Head of Sustainable Development.
Reason: In the interests of the visual amenities of the area and to ensure the creation of a pleasant environment for the development. (Policy: G2 (OSP2011); G2 (OSP2016); G8 (SOLP); C2 (SOLP2011)).
That all planting, seeding or turfing comprised in the approved details of landscaping shall be carried out in the first planting season following the occupation of the buildings or the completion of the development, whichever is the sooner, and any trees or plants which within a period of five years die, are removed or become seriously damaged shall be replaced in the next planting season with others of similar size and species, unless the Head of Sustainable Development gives written consent to any variations.
Reason: In the interests of the visual amenities of the area and to ensure the creation of a pleasant environment for the development. (Policy: G2 (OSP2011); G2 (OSP2016); G8 (SOLP); C2 (SOLP2011)).
That no development shall take place until the trees on the site which are to be retained and which are adjacent to or within the development area, have been protected during building operations by means of a protective fence around the edge of the canopy of the trees in accordance with B.S. 5837: 1991, and with the written requirements (copy attached) of the Head of Sustainable Development relating to the protection of trees. Furthermore, no works or storing of plant or materials shall be carried out within the fenced area.
Reason: To ensure the protection of trees on the land and to preserve the amenities of the locality. (Policy: G2 (OSP2011); G2 (OSP2016); G8 (SOLP); C2 (SOLP2011)).
That the car park be laid out, constructed, surfaced and drained in all respects to the satisfaction of the Head of Sustainable Development prior to the new school building being brought into use.
Reason: To ensure that adequate car parking provision is made. (Policy: G11 (SOLP); D2 (SOLP2011)).
That details of any perimeter fencing or boundary treatment sh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development before the development commences.
Reason: In the interests of the amenities of neighbouring residents. (Policy: G8 (SOLP); G6 (SOLP2011)).
That details of any external lighting to be provided within the site sh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development before it is installed.
Reason: In the interests of the amenities of neighbouring residents. (Policy: G8 (SOLP); G6 (SOLP2011)).
That final details of the new school layby to be provided on High Street sh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development before the development commences. Any details approved shall be implemented as soon as the new access road to serve the adjoining housing development site to the east is completed.
Reason: In the interests of highway safety. (Policy: G3 (OSP2011)).
That no development shall take place until a professionally competent archaeological organisation as appro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development, has been commissioned to carry out a full watching brief during the period of construction works. The watching brief shall preserve by record any archaeological features, which may arise in the course of works and shall include limited archaeological excavation where necessary and the retrieval of artefactual evidence.
Reason: To safeguard the recording and inspection of matters of archaeological importance on the site. (Policy: EN10 (OSP2011)).
That the School shall prepare a School Travel Plan which is to be submitted to and approved by the Head of Sustainable Development following consultation with the Travel Plans Development Team and that plan must be put into operation by the start of the Spring term 2005.
Reason: In the interest of highway safety and to encourage more suitable means of transport. (Policy: T1 (OSP2011); T1 (OSP2016)).
That the school shall not be occupied until a scheme for the provision of adequate, convenient, secure and covered cycle parking as appropriate has been submitted to and approved by the Head of Sustainable Development and any such approved scheme implemented.
Reason: To ensure that adequate cycle parking is provided to encourage more sustainable means of travel to the school. (Policy: T1, T4 (OSP2011); G11 (SOLP); D2 (SOLP2011)).
That final details of the proposed new gateway through the boundary wall into the walled playing field in the western half of the site sh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Head of Sustainable Development before development commences.
Reason: In the interests of visual amenity. (Policy: EN8 (OSP2011); EN4 (OSP2016); CON15 (SOLP); CON10 (SOLP2011)).
